EXPLANATORY NOTE
Digimarc Corporation (the “Company”) is filing this Amendment No. 1 on Form
10-K/A
(this “Amendment”) to amend the Company’s Annual Report on Form
10-K
for the fiscal year ended December 31, 2024 (the “Original Filing”), which was originally filed with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(the “SEC”) on February 27, 2025 (the “Original Filing Date”). The sole purpose of this Amendment is to supplement the Exhibits contained in Item 15(a)(3) of the Original Filing to include Exhibit 19, Insider Trading Policy, under Section 12 of the Securities Exchange Act of 1934, as amended, which was inadvertently omitted in the Original Filing.
This Amendment is an exhibit-only filing. Except as described above, no changes have been made to the Original Filing and this Amendment does not modify, amend, or update in any way any of the financial or other information contained in the Original Filing. This Amendment does not reflect events that may have occurred subsequent to the Original Filing Date. Accordingly, this Amendment should be read in conjunction with the Original Filing and the Company’s other filings with the SEC.

The agreements included or incorporated by reference as exhibits to this report may contain representations and warranties by each of the parties to the applicable agreement. These representations and warranties have been made solely for the benefit of the other party or parties to the applicable agreement and:

 

   

were not intended to be treated as categorical statements of fact, but rather as a means of allocating the risk to one of the parties if those statements prove to be inaccurate;

 

   

were qualified by disclosures that were made to the other party or parties in connection with the negotiation of the applicable agreement, which disclosures are not necessarily reflected in the agreement;

 

   

may apply standards of “materiality” that are different from “materiality” under the securities laws; and

 

   

were made only as of the date of the applicable agreement or other date or dates that may be specified in the agreement.

Accordingly, these representations and warranties may not describe the actual state of affairs as of the date they were made or at any other time.
